Who needs statutory form power of?
01
Statutory form power of may be needed by individuals who wish to grant someone else the authority to act on their behalf in legal, financial, or healthcare matters.
02
Specifically, it may be needed by individuals who are:
03
- Planning for long-term travel or residing in another country
04
- Physically or mentally incapacitated and require assistance with managing their affairs
05
- Deployed or serving in the military
06
- In need of someone to handle financial transactions or property matters in their absence
07
- Seeking to appoint a representative to make healthcare decisions on their behalf
08
- Considering estate planning and want to ensure a smooth transfer of assets in the future
09
It is advisable to consult with a legal professional to determine if a statutory form power of is appropriate for your specific situation.
